Things You'll Need:
- Lobster
- Cream
- Butter
- Flour
- Milk
- Salt
- Paprika
- Flour
- Parsley
-
Step 1
In a medium size cooking pan place 4 tablespoons of butter. Turn heat on low and melt the butter. Next:add to the pan 3 tablespoons of finely chopped fresh onion. Cook onion on low heat in butter until softened.
-
Step 2
The next step is to add to the cooking pan 2 tablespoons of flour and stir constantly until blended. Next add the following ingredients to the pan: 3 cups of milk, 1/2 teaspoon of salt, 1/4 teaspoon of paprika, and 1 cup of heavy cream. Cook on low heat until mixture thickens, and remember to stir the mixture constantly so it will not burn or stick to the bottom of your cooking pan.
-
Step 3
Add to the pan the meat of one lobster and 2 tablespoons of chopped fresh parsley. Warm. Serve immediately in 4 decorative soup bowls.
